linell wrote:Hi all, the Cradley Vicar's Notebook have a David and Sarah Harris living with John and Eliza Bloomer Colley Lane Cradley 1863/64, David and Sarah Harris have a one year old son Joseph.
There's another David and Sarah Harris living on their own, in The Innage Cradley at the same time. The Vicar has no notes on them except to say +3, which I take to mean that Sarah was three months pregnant. I think this is the couple who are in Cradley in 1871 with a daughter Anna M aged 6 in 1871. David was aged 36 so born 1835, which makes him to old to be the son of Joseph and Mary Harris from Lomey Town their son was born 1844/5.
Has anyone found David born 1844/5 with a son Joseph born 1864 in 1871?
Linell.
